Job Description

PagerDuty Inc. (NYSE:PD) is a global leader in digital operations management. Half of the Fortune 500 and nearly 70% of the Fortune 100 trust PagerDuty as essential infrastructure.

Join us. At PagerDuty youll tackle complex problems collaborate with kind and ambitious people and help build a more equitable worldall in a flexible award-winning workplace.

PagerDuty is seeking a Majors Account Executive with experience in growing existing accounts and acquiring new business. In this hybrid role you will report to a Regional Sales Director. You will be responsible for expanding opportunities within a set of existing high-value accounts while also driving new customer acquisition. Were looking for a dynamic consultative sales leader who understands the nuances of nurturing long-term relationships and winning new businesssomeone who thrives in a tech-forward environment and is passionate about delivering impactful solutions.

You will manage a portfolio of approximately 30 to 50 accounts focusing on a balanced approach to expanding existing relationships and prospecting for new logos within the space. Your ability to align our operations cloud story with multiple stakeholders across these accounts while identifying and closing new business is key to your success.

As a customer-centric organization PagerDuty emphasizes exceptional sales experiences. Were seeking someone who can build lasting relationships while pursuing strategic growth. This role is an exciting opportunity to showcase your sales expertise leverage your tech skills and make a significant impact by growing and diversifying the customer base.

Key Responsibilities

  • Value Selling
    Focus on demonstrating the unique value our products and services bring to both new and existing customers addressing specific needs and challenges that drive their business forward.
  • Account Expansion & Acquisition
    Balance your time between growing existing accounts and prospecting for new business. Identify new revenue opportunities within current accounts while developing and executing strategies to win new accounts including crafting tailored outreach to key decision-makers.
  • Strategic Account Development
    Develop and execute strategic plans to expand accounts and identify new high-potential opportunities. Stay aligned with customer objectives and business needs while leveraging competitive intelligence and industry trends.
  • Sales Effectiveness
    Establish and maintain strong authentic relationships with both new and existing clients. Negotiate positive outcomes ensuring mutual success with current accounts while securing new deals with prospective clients.
  • Executive Engagement
    Conduct high-level conversations with senior executives (VP) to uncover strategic needs and align our solutions to their business challenges. Lead discussions around both new sales opportunities and expansions within existing accounts.
  • Sales Execution
    Ensure thorough and accurate pipeline management with careful preparation for meetings and presentations. Follow up on commitments and agreements to contribute to the long-term strategic success of both the customer and PagerDuty.
  • Prospecting & New Business Development
    Utilize marketing alliances and BDR programs to uncover new logo opportunities. Proactively qualify prospects develop strategies to win new business and create plans to convert leads into customers.
  • Planning & Forecasting
    Map out territory and account strategies working with internal resources to develop an effective sales approach. Use historical data and market insights to provide accurate and actionable forecasts.
  • Cross-functional Collaboration
    Engage the right internal resources at the right time coordinating with support teams to drive deals forward across existing and new accounts. Ensure a seamless customer experience from prospecting to post-sale.

Basic Qualifications

  • 5 years of field sales experience with a focus on software/SaaS sales
  • 3 years of experience in expanding relationships within existing accounts and acquiring new business
  • Commercial or Enterprise Account Management experience with $500M Global 2000 companies
  • Proven track record in selling across multiple products or services

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ience supporting customers in the Northeast US and Southern Ontario
  • Strong time management complex deal management account planning and analytical skills
  • Consistent history of exceeding sales targets and driving revenue growth
  • Self-starter with the ability to work independently and collaborate effectively with teams
  • Experience with Sales Methodology training (e.g. MEDDIC SPIN Command of Message Challenger Sales)

Additional Details

The base salary range for this position is 105000 - 125000 CAD. This role may also be eligible for bonus commission equity and/or benefits.

Our base salary ranges are determined by role level and location. The range which is subject to change based on primary work location reflects the minimum and maximum base salary we expect to pay newly hired employees for the position. Within the range we determine pay for an individual based on a number of factors including market location job-related knowledge skills/competencies and experience.

Your recruiter can share more about the specific offerings for this role as well as the salary range for your primary work location during the hiring process.

About PagerDuty

PagerDuty Inc. (NYSE:PD) is a global leader in digital operations management enabling customers to achieve operational efficiency at scale with the PagerDuty Operations Cloud. The PagerDuty Operations Cloud combines AIOps Automation Customer Service Operations and Incident Management with a powerful generative AI assistant to create a flexible resilient and scalable platform to increase innovation velocity grow revenue reduce cost and mitigate the risk of operational failure. Half of the Fortune 500 and nearly 70% of the Fortune 100 rely on PagerDuty as essential infrastructure for the modern enterprise.

PagerDuty is Great Place to Work-certified a Fortune Best Workplace for Millennials a Fortune Best Medium Workplace a Fortune Best Workplace in Technology and a top rated product on TrustRadius and G2.
